Frequently Asked Questions

How do I keep my Kentucky Bluegrass and Tall Fescue blend green without overwatering?

Under Pennville's voluntary conservation status, precision is key. An ET-based (evapotranspiration) Wi-Fi irrigation controller uses live weather data to apply only the water the turf has actually lost. This system automatically adjusts for rainfall, humidity, and temperature, delivering deep, infrequent watering that promotes drought-tolerant root depth in your grass blend. This method optimizes plant health while strictly adhering to municipal water use guidelines and pre-empting potential mandatory restrictions.

My yard holds water every spring. What's a lasting solution that also looks good?

Moderate runoff and seasonal saturation are predictable in Pennville's acidic silt loam due to its naturally slow percolation. A functional solution involves regrading to create positive drainage away from foundations and installing subsurface French drains where necessary. For surfacing, replacing impermeable materials with permeable installations of Pennsylvania Bluestone pavers allows stormwater to infiltrate directly into the soil, meeting Pennville Department of Planning and Zoning runoff reduction standards while providing a durable, aesthetic hardscape.

Why does my lawn have compacted, poor soil that struggles to grow anything?

Properties in Pennville Heights, built around 1987, have soils approaching 40 years of maturity. The predominant acidic silt loam common here was initially graded and compacted during construction, leading to low organic matter and poor permeability. This compaction inhibits root growth and water infiltration, creating seasonal saturation issues. Core aeration combined with incorporating composted organic matter is the foundational correction, rebuilding soil structure and microbial activity for long-term plant health.

Is there a lower-maintenance, more ecological alternative to my traditional lawn?

Transitioning high-input turf areas to a xeriscape of regionally native plants like Eastern Redbud, Switchgrass, New England Aster, and Wild Bergamot significantly reduces water, fertilizer, and maintenance demands. These plants are adapted to Zone 6b conditions and Pennville's soil pH, requiring no chemical inputs once established.
